Historical Foundations: Legacy Online Casinos and Their Limitations

Online casinos began in the mid-1990s, coinciding with the advent of internet commerce. These early platforms, often basic in design and functionality, laid the groundwork for a burgeoning industry. However, they faced notable limitations such as constrained game variety, limited security protocols, and suboptimal user experiences.

Data from industry reports indicates that in 2005, the global online gambling market was valued at approximately $8 billion, with a significant portion attributed to early online casinos leveraging relatively primitive technology. These platforms primarily employed downloadable software and rudimentary user interfaces, which hindered accessibility and scalability.

Technological Innovations: The Rise of Mobile and Live Dealer Platforms

The 2010s marked a seismic shift, with mobile devices becoming ubiquitous and enabling 24/7 access to casino games. Concurrently, live dealer technologies emerged, bridging the gap between online and physical casinos. These advancements fostered a more immersive player experience, fostering trust and engagement.

Technological Milestone Impact on Industry
HTML5 Gaming Enhanced compatibility across devices, reducing reliance on downloads
Live Streaming Increased realism and transparency in gameplay
Cryptocurrency Payments Improved transaction security and privacy

Amidst these developments, regulatory frameworks also evolved, leading to the emergence of licensed online casinos with rigorous standards to ensure fair play and player protection.

Current Trends: The Integration of AI, Blockchain, and Personalization

Today, industry leaders leverage artificial intelligence (AI) to personalize gaming experiences, optimize customer support, and detect fraudulent activity. Blockchain technology further enhances transparency, especially with the advent of provably fair gaming mechanisms.

Considering the diversification in offerings, innovative online casinos now incorporate:

  • Augmented Reality (AR) interfaces
  • Skill-based gaming options
  • Enhanced responsible gambling tools

The Role of Responsible Gaming and Regulatory Oversight

With growth comes the necessity for stringent oversight. Regulatory authorities across jurisdictions such as the UK, Malta, and Gibraltar enforce licensing and fairness standards. Additionally, responsible gambling initiatives, including self-exclusion and expenditure limits, are now integrated into most platforms to promote safer gambling environments.
